Form 4/A is a fil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) that is used to report changes in ownership of company stock by insiders. This includes purchases, sales, and exercises of stock options. By requiring insiders to disclose their transactions, the SEC aims to promote transparency and protect investors from insider trading. Investors can track these filings to gain insights into the sentiment and actions of company insiders.
